Output 83778290213c2e691140866345786d81f9cce7b08e4a650e6139a115390f5037:25

value
25900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e301043e131db3728125f934b73192f45f15a05 OP_EQUAL
address
MNKaaFbLpz3EZb35Bck3TpLfQHL1Npee63
transaction
83778290213c2e691140866345786d81f9cce7b08e4a650e6139a115390f5037
spent
true